2024 Associate Embedded Software Engineer

Thales Defense & Security, Inc.
Clarksburg, MD, US
Full-time

Overview

Thales Defense & Security, Inc. is a global company serving the defense, federal, and commercial markets with innovative solutions for the ground tactical, airborne and avionics, naval / maritime, and public safety and security domains.

  • In addition to mission-critical communication systems, the company provides helmet-mounted displays and motion tracking technologies;
  • SATCOM terminals; advanced sonar systems; and data protection solutions. Furthermore, the company serves as a gateway for technology, leveraging Thales-wide solutions such as combat management systems;

naval, airborne, and ground ISR; and electronic warfare to address U.S. requirements.

Please Note : The incumbent must be prepared to start in Clarksburg, MD in Summer 2024.

Top Benefits

  • Competitive Salary
  • Yearly Incentive Bonus Program
  • Generous 401(k) program - up to 7% company contribution and 100% immediate vesting
  • Tuition Reimbursement
  • Paid wellness, vacation, and holiday leave
  • Paid maternity, paternity, and parental leave
  • 9 / 80 Work Schedule (every other Friday off)
  • Hybrid working environment

Responsibilities

This position is for an Associate Embedded Software Engineer in Clarksburg, MD. This position requires a highly motivated individual to work with the Embedded Software Design team to perform low level design and support engineering tasks for embedded wireless communications systems.

Responsibilities will span the software development lifecycle including requirements generation, system design and implementation, integration, and testing support.

Qualifications

  • U.S. Citizenship. Applicants selected may be subject to a government security investigation and must meet eligibility requirements for access to classified information.
  • 0-2 years' experience with BSEE / BSCE / BSME / BSCS or equivalent.
  • Excellent oral and written communication skills.
  • Ability to work collaboratively and build and maintain relationships with team members.
  • Software development for embedded systems in a Linux environment.

Preferred Experience with the following :

  • The software development process (peer reviews, unit testing, configuration management, defect tracking).
  • Developing software in C / C++, Python.
  • Agile methodologies and techniques such as Scrum, Kanban, Test Driven Development, etc.
  • Wireless communication systems and networking.
  • Embedded Linux on ARM processors.
  • 30+ days ago
Related jobs
Promoted
Capital One
North Potomac, Maryland

Center 3 (19075), United States of America, McLean, VirginiaLead Software Engineer, Full Stack - Associate ProductivityDo you love building and pioneering in the technology space? Do you enjoy solving complex business problems in a fast-paced, collaborative, inclusive, and iterative delivery environ...

Promoted
Leonardo DRS
Frederick, Maryland

Design, develop, analyze, test and debug of computer software applications and/or systems mostly in a Real-time embedded environment. Bachelor's degree in engineering or related technical field with a minimum of 8 years of experience in software development. Strong experience with modern software de...

Promoted
Capital One
North Bethesda, Maryland

Center 3 (19075), United States of America, McLean, VirginiaLead Software Engineer, Full Stack - Associate ProductivityDo you love building and pioneering in the technology space? Do you enjoy solving complex business problems in a fast-paced, collaborative, inclusive, and iterative delivery environ...

Thales Defense & Security, Inc.
Clarksburg, Maryland

This position is for an Associate Embedded Software Engineer in Clarksburg, MD. This position requires a highly motivated individual to work with the Embedded Software Design team to perform low level design and support engineering tasks for embedded wireless communications systems. Software develop...

BD
Loveton Circle,Sparks,USA MD

Opening for a full product lifecycle bare metal embedded firmware engineer familiar with techniques and tooling of C/C++ microcontroller development in medical test equipment. This person works with the Electrical Engineering department to understand and advise the required hardware interfaces, the ...

Thales Defense & Security, Inc.
Clarksburg, Maryland

Our Clarksburg MD office is seeking an Associate DSP Software Engineer. Please Note: The incumbent must be prepared to start in Clarksburg, MD in Summer 2024. Take part in TDSI Agile/SCRUM software development process. ...

NPAworldwide
Gaithersburg, Maryland

As an Embedded Software Engineer you will play a crucial role in designing, developing, and optimizing embedded software solutions for our autonomous driving systems. Bachelor's or Master's degree in Computer/Electrical Engineering, Computer Science, or a related field. ...

Intellian Technologies
Rockville, Maryland

Senior Embedded Software Engineer (with 8+ years experience). Mentor junior software engineers. You will collaborate with our hardware, software, and manufacturing teams as well as external vendors to help provide best-in-class solutions for our customers. Define, design, develop, and test software ...

Thales Defense & Security, Inc.
Clarksburg, Maryland

Software Engineering department for 8 weeks during the summer of 2024. This position will be responsible for some entry-level assignments that will provide exposure to the software engineering job family. This position is located in the Clarksburg, MD office and reports to the Manager of Engineering...

EchoStar
Gaithersburg, Maryland

Master’s degree in Computer Science, Computer Networks, Computer Engineering or a closely related field plus 6 months’ experience in embedded software applications or Bachelor’s degree in Computer Science, Computer Networks, Computer Engineering or a closely related field plus 5 years’ experience in...